1. Royal Chicken and Pumpkin Mash

Heavy cats love the savory taste of real chicken mixed with sweet pumpkin. Pumpkin provides natural fiber to help your pet feel full without adding useless calories. Lean chicken breast gives them the pure protein they need to stay strong.
Ingredients
- 1 cup boiled chicken breast chopped fine
- 2 tablespoons plain pumpkin puree
- 1 tablespoon unsalted chicken broth
Instructions
- Place the chopped chicken breast in a clean bowl
- Add the plain pumpkin puree to the chicken
- Pour the unsalted chicken broth over the top
- Mix the ingredients well with a spoon until smooth
- Serve a small portion to your cat at room temperature
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 140 kcal |
| Protein | 25 grams |
| Fat | 3 grams |
2. Majestic Turkey and Spinach Feast

Ground turkey offers a fantastic low fat alternative to rich meats. Minced spinach adds vital vitamins and minerals to support a healthy immune system. Your regal feline will enjoy the smooth texture and rich aroma of this hearty dinner.
Ingredients
- 1 cup lean ground turkey cooked
- 1 tablespoon steamed spinach minced
- 1 teaspoon salmon oil
Instructions
- Cook the lean ground turkey completely in a pan
- Let the cooked turkey cool to room temperature
- Chop the steamed spinach into very small pieces
- Combine the turkey and spinach in a bowl
- Drizzle the salmon oil over the mixture and stir
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 155 kcal |
| Protein | 22 grams |
| Fat | 4 grams |
3. Sovereign Salmon and Celery Stew

Fish loving royalty will adore this low calorie salmon stew. Celery provides a nice crunch and hydration while keeping the calorie count very low. Pure salmon provides essential omega fatty acids that make your cat coat shine beautifully.
Ingredients
- 3 ounces fresh salmon cooked and flaked
- 1 teaspoon celery finely diced
- 2 tablespoons water
Instructions
- Bake or steam the fresh salmon until it flakes easily
- Remove all bones from the fish carefully
- Mash the salmon in a small serving dish
- Stir in the finely diced celery pieces
- Add water to create a moist stew consistency
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 120 kcal |
| Protein | 18 grams |
| Fat | 5 grams |
4. Noble Beef and Zucchini Broth

Lean beef provides rich iron and deep flavor that satisfies big appetites. Grated zucchini blends into the meat to lower the total calorie density of the meal. Royal pets get a huge portion size without gaining unwanted fat.
Ingredients
- 1 cup extra lean ground beef cooked
- 2 tablespoons zucchini grated
- 2 tablespoons warm water
Instructions
- Brown the extra lean ground beef thoroughly in a skillet
- Drain away any excess grease from the meat
- Mix the grated zucchini into the warm beef
- Add warm water to make a tasty broth
- Allow the meal to cool before serving
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 160 kcal |
| Protein | 24 grams |
| Fat | 6 grams |
5. Imperial Whitefish and Carrot Delight

Whitefish is an excellent option for felines on a strict weight loss plan. Cooked carrots provide natural sweetness and a boost of antioxidants for eye health. Cats enjoy the delicate flavor profile of this ocean inspired dish.
Ingredients
- 1 cup cod or haddock flaked
- 1 tablespoon cooked carrots mashed
- 1 teaspoon olive oil
Instructions
- Poach the whitefish in plain water until tender
- Flake the fish apart to check for hidden bones
- Mash the cooked carrots into a soft paste
- Blend the fish and carrots together gently
- Stir in the olive oil for healthy fats
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 115 kcal |
| Protein | 20 grams |
| Fat | 3 grams |
6. Crowned Venison and Green Bean Mix

Venison is a novel protein that works wonders for chubby cats. Green beans offer great volume and fiber to prevent begging between scheduled meals. Your royal pet will feel completely full and pampered by this rare treat.
Ingredients
- 3 ounces lean venison meat cooked
- 2 tablespoons green beans steamed and minced
- 1 tablespoon unsalted beef broth
Instructions
- Cook the venison meat thoroughly until tender
- Mince the venison into tiny bite size pieces
- Steam the green beans and chop them very fine
- Toss the meat and green beans together in a bowl
- Moisten the food with the unsalted beef broth
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 135 kcal |
| Protein | 23 grams |
| Fat | 4 grams |
7. Regency Egg and Chicken Liver Medley

Chicken liver provides intense taste and critical nutrients in tiny portions. Scrambled egg whites add pure protein without the heavy fat found in the yolk. Majestic cats will appreciate the gourmet scent of this rich breakfast bowl.
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ons chicken liver boiled and minced
- 1 large egg white scrambled
- 1 tablespoon warm water
Instructions
- Boil the chicken liver until it is cooked completely
- Mince the liver into a fine paste
- Scramble the egg white in a nonstick pan without oil
- Chop the cooked egg white into small bits
- Combine the liver and egg white with warm water
| Nutrient | Amount |
| Calories | 95 kcal |
| Protein | 14 grams |
| Fat | 3 grams |
